/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} What part of the give was susceptible to betting conditions?

What part of the give was susceptible to betting conditions?

Sign-up Bonuses & No-deposit Bonuses to the 2025

Delivering obvious reasons, no deposit incentives are the players' favorite bonus professionals. Due to big no deposit incentives, you can test casinos' gambling lobbies and you may see brand new their favorite online casino games a hundred% free. This will help to you decide even if an on-line gambling establishment is a superb complement your or else perhaps not. In cases like this, you might proceed to generate in initial deposit and you will allege other extra perks.

Testing

Online casino fans and you can supporters like zero-put bonuses (also known as Sign up bonuses, KYC bonuses otherwise Options-one hundred % totally free incentives) more other a lot more has the benefit of only for that can cause, to get it, and come up with at least qualifying lay is not needed. Online casinos promote individuals like incentive offers, as well as no deposit most cash, no deposit 100 percent free take pleasure in, no-deposit free spins, and additionally no-deposit extra has the benefit of you to definitely combine multiple bonuses. Below, i here are a few several of the most better-known additional types.

No-deposit one hundred % 100 percent free Cash

So you're able to claim 100 % 100 percent free finance within this an online local casino, you will want to indication-up getting an account earliest. Along with your 100 percent free bucks a lot more, you are able to try out brand of real cash to your-range gambling establishment online game and you will be in a position to gather the individual most earnings once you've came across their added bonus wagering conditions. The latest playing requirements dedicated to the fresh new no-deposit extra let you know how often you need to wager regarding bonus currency you may get to obtain the other profits.

What exactly are Betting Requirements?

Betting conditions are also called playthrough standards. WR are part of the conditions and terms so you can features a no deposit extra. Betting conditions was multiplier rules away from strategy. It means about how precisely several times Participants you need rollover the main benefit in advance of they could withdraw people loans.

How exactly to Measure the the latest Betting Demands

An effective $20 zero-deposit extra susceptible to a beneficial 30X betting called http://www.palmsbetcasino.uk.net/no-deposit-bonus/ for form that pages need choices their extra count a total of thirty X ($600 in wagers) just before cashing away some one money. Anyone attempt to withdraw versus fulfilling the newest playthrough requirements commonly void the advantage + winnings into the membership.

The new area of the give that is confronted by wagering conditions is sometimes shown from the even more conditions and terms. Betting standards applies so you're able to one another deposit suits bonuses and you can free revolves incentives, and perhaps, playing criteria ount.

Facts

Which have incredible rewards and positives, there's absolutely no inquire why extremely internet casino anyone prefer subscribe incentives over most other more offers. You can utilize allege a no cost extra without the financial commitment and it will become the essential tempting element of no deposit most prize. When you find yourself offered providing a zero-deposit extra, take a look at the a guide looked the following basic.

Browse the Terms and conditions

This is certainly that suggestion you should keep in mind no matter and therefore on-line casino bonus we should claim. Generally, you usually must have a look at fine print, and look towards the minuscule text towards requirements and you may conditions webpage as this is the only way to rating all the important information and you can understand the best value of the main benefit your should claim. Basically, incentives that are entitled to their appeal are those making use of the ways down betting requirements and you will huge limit cashout constraints. In addition, you is discover zero-deposit bonuses which can be removed for the a much bigger set of games, towards video game you�lso are certainly looking for to try out. Possible end incentives and that is only available merely on one online game. When searching regarding bonus terms and conditions, definitely check out the betting standards, eligible game, limitation playing constraints, and you will everything else.

Discover virtue That meets The Betting Demands

As you know, there can be a whole a number of no deposit or any other gambling establishment bonuses and you may promotions, that it is practical to invest sometime contrasting this form of various other incentives in order to find one that works best for their specific betting need and you may needs. According to your betting choices, free bucks, and you can a hundred % totally free take pleasure in incentives age date, it seems sensible to a target a hundred % free revolves bonuses for people who is actually a keen position partner.

Choose brand new Satisfying Discounts

Of a lot sweet zero-deposit incentives are merely redeemable through added bonus standards. Using this type of have been shown, we wish to spend some time seeking the greatest bonus codes. To make it simpler for you, the specialist cluster supplies the best discounts off this kind so you can improve its gaming be. Using this bringing told you, be sure to on a regular basis speak about the selection of bonus standards to not miss any the new promotions we you are going to has obtaining players.

Know the way Different types of No-put Incentives Really works

As soon as we discussed in one of the previous bits, no deposit incentives have different forms, and you will finding out how almost every other incentives of this type work will help you comprehend the the fresh now offers that fit their to relax and play layout and you may finances. Should you get a totally free enjoy added bonus, remember it can you need to be utilized within this an effective certain months. If you get a free spins bonus, think about you merely rating free revolves to make use of towards qualified online game.

Subscribe to The book

That have online casinos constantly enriching its bonus provider that have the latest zero place added bonus also offers, you have got an enormous style of incentive advantageous assets to profit out-of. not, not absolutely all incentives are just as value your appeal. And that, we would like to get involved in our intimate-knit area as we has an expert class that works well unlimited factors selecting the better gambling enterprise bonuses and ads. Listed below are some the study out of no deposit gambling enterprises so you're able to get the best iGaming webpages to you personally.

The way we Price

How Our Advantages Price Web based casinos and you may To tackle Web sites: Investigating gambling enterprises is exactly what we might finest, therefore we ensure that we protection the new necessary data and also issues. Regarding and that online casino to decide, we are going to provide most up to date information about a keen advanced casino's security measures, profits, representative opinions towards casino, and much more. Investigate chart below for more information.

Our specialist ratings tend to render additional aide to finding the fresh best and more than satisfying web based casinos. Regarding the list an effective casino's games library, banking alternatives, customer care, and all the initial a number of when choosing a gambling establishment, the latest expert reviewers put the electricity on the give.Find out more about how exactly we costs